COVID-19 大流行:紧急分诊的伦理问题和建议。

COVID-19 pandemic: ethical issues and recommendations for emergency triage.

Abstract

The current epidemic of Coronavirus Disease 2019 (COVID-19) has become a public health event worldwide. Through ethical analysis of a series of epidemic prevention phenomena and epidemic prevention measures taken by the Chinese (and other countries) government and medical institutions during the COVID-19 pandemic, this paper discusses a series of ethical difficulties in hospital emergency triage caused by the COVID-19, including the autonomy limitation of patients and waste of epidemic prevention resources due to over-triage, the safety problem of patients because of inaccurate feedback information from intelligent epidemic prevention technology, and conflicts between individual interests of patients and public interests due to the "strict" implementation of the pandemic prevention and control system. In addition, we also discuss the solution path and strategy of these ethical issues from the perspective of system design and implementation based on the Care Ethics theory.

摘要

当前 2019 冠状病毒病(COVID-19)疫情已成为全球范围内的公共卫生事件。通过对 COVID-19 大流行期间中国(和其他国家)政府和医疗机构采取的一系列疫情防控现象和防控措施进行伦理分析,本文讨论了 COVID-19 导致的医院急诊分诊中出现的一系列伦理困境,包括因过诊而导致的患者自主权受限和疫情防控资源浪费、智能疫情防控技术因反馈信息不准确而导致的患者安全问题,以及由于大流行防控体系的“严格”执行而导致的患者个体利益与公共利益之间的冲突。此外,我们还从关怀伦理理论的角度出发,通过系统设计和实施来探讨这些伦理问题的解决路径和策略。
